Why water has maximum density at 4°C ?

Answer» Water in form of ice has 4 H bonds forming cage structure,hence has low density.but as ice melt water occupies vacant space and hence it\'s density increases . this occurs till 4°C, after that water expand,so volume increases, density decreases.Thus, water has maximum density at 4°C.
